I voluntarily dropped my rating to 1200 by skipping lot's of ELO puzzles. Now I'm presented with much easier puzzles and I've noticed that almost none of them are rated, because you have to have an ELO of over 1600 before you can rate. That way, simple problems will never be rated, because players can't rate them and thus, never be considered for deletion.
Suggestion: Instead of using a fixed threshold of 1600 ELO points before you can rate, you could use a dynamic system. For example, if a player's ELO rating exceeds the puzzles rating by over 200 points, the player can rate
